XP Power announced six new series of isolated DC-DC converters in industry standard SMD packages. Offered in single- and dual-output versions, the compact devices are available in power ranges from 0,25 to 3 Watts.
Both regulated and unregulated output models are available. The ISA, ISE, ISH and ISK series offer unregulated outputs while the ISR and ISW have regulated outputs. Exhibiting versatility, the ISE and ISA ranges provide 1 W of output power with single and dual unregulated outputs respectively. The ISH is a 2 W version of the ISE range, and the ISK offers an unregulated 0,25 W single output. In addition the ISW is a 1 W single-output converter with a regulated output, with the ISR range providing a regulated 3 W single output.
There are various combinations of single-output models from 3,3 to 24 V, and dual-output models with outputs of ±5, ±9, ±12, ±15 and ±24 V. Each series offers up to five ±10% input voltage ranges or a 2:1 input range on the ISR series.
Offering standard 1500 or optional 3000 V input/output isolation, the converters measure just 12,7 x 8,3 x 7,25 mm for the ISE, ISH and ISK ranges. The ISA and ISW measure 15,24 x 8,30 x 7,25 mm and the ISR measures 23,86 x 13,70 x 8,00 mm. All have industry standard pin-outs.
The devices feature an extended operating temperature range of -40°C to +105°C for the ISA, ISE, ISH, ISK and ISR ranges (+85°C for ISW) and full output power up to +100°C is achievable (+85°C for ISR and +70°C for ISW).
These DC-DC converter ranges are suitable for use in application areas including automation and process control, broadcast, instrumentation, mobile communications, and various other compact electronic equipment.
